Output 3ab0e586084da77fea5af2c69992bd1a825f0f3871d2a9daff82cb7ab0c9914f:2

value
46301489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6ec509380a8b0d1b977a024e545bab338566e6 OP_EQUAL
address
MLX8BKCHuHqN9zQxmZYGuGMsoArNVRvXcB
transaction
3ab0e586084da77fea5af2c69992bd1a825f0f3871d2a9daff82cb7ab0c9914f
spent
true